When Qui-Gon's voice calls to Anakin while he's killing Sand People it's followed by a long "Nooooooooooooooo". But you can't really tell who says the "Nooooooooooooooo". It could be Qui-Gon trying to get Anakin to stop. Or it could be Anakin, foreshadowing his future transformation into Vader.
